ソースを参照

相机上传文件接口返回结果增加打印文件路径

dsx 2 年 前
コミット
0992ef9505

+ 4 - 5
src/main/java/com/fdkankan/contro/service/impl/SceneFileBuildServiceImpl.java

@@ -1889,16 +1889,16 @@ public class SceneFileBuildServiceImpl extends ServiceImpl<ISceneFileBuildMapper
                 }
                 result = ResultData.ok();
             }else if (!md5.equals(fileMD5)) {
-                log.error("文件已上传,上传MD5:"+md5+",服务器MD5:"+fileMD5+"。不一致。上传失败");
+                log.info("文件已上传,上传MD5:"+md5+",服务器MD5:"+fileMD5+"。不一致。需要重新上传");
                 FileUtils.delFile(yunFilePath.toString());
                 needUpload = true;
             }else if (yunFile.length() != size){
-                log.error("文件已上传,文件大小不一致。上传失败");
+                log.info("文件已上传,文件大小不一致。需要重新上传");
                 FileUtils.delFile(yunFilePath);
                 needUpload = true;
             }
         }else {
-            log.error("文件不存在,需要重新上传");
+            log.info("文件不存在,需要重新上传");
             needUpload = true;
         }
 
@@ -1920,10 +1920,9 @@ public class SceneFileBuildServiceImpl extends ServiceImpl<ISceneFileBuildMapper
 
                 if (md5.equals(fileMD5) && uploadFile.length() == size){
                     log.info("文件已上传,MD5和文件大小一致。上传成功");
-
                     sceneFileUploadEntity.setUploadStatus(1);
                     sceneFileUploadService.save(sceneFileUploadEntity);
-                    result = ResultData.ok();
+                    result = ResultData.ok(sceneFileUploadEntity.getFilePath());
                 }else if (!md5.equals(fileMD5)) {
                     log.error("文件已上传,上传MD5:"+md5+",服务器MD5:"+fileMD5+"。不一致。上传失败");
                     sceneFileUploadEntity.setUploadStatus(-1);